اگر قصد دارید پروتکل سایت خود را از https به http تغییر دهید؛ اما نمی دانید که چه تاثیری بر روی سایت شما خواهد گذاشت، این مقاله مخصوص شما است. ما در این مقاله قصد داریم در مورد این که https با http چه فرقی دارد و چه تفاوت هایی از لحاظ عملکرد، امنیت و مزایایی که برای بهینه سازی موتور های جستجو به همراه خواهد داشت، توضیح دهیم. برای آشنایی بیشتر با این دو پروتکل ادامه مقاله را از دست ندهید.

تفاوت اصلی چیست؟

 

http مخفف Hypertext Transfer Protocol است. این پروتکل باعث می شود تا ارتباط بین سیستم های مختلف و انتقال داده بین آن ها از طریق شبکه امکان پذیر شود. در نقطه مقابل https قرار دارد که مخفف Hypertext Transfer Protocol Secure است. https نیز مانند http عمل می کند؛ اما تفاوتی که میان این دو وجود دارد این است که https برای محافظت از ارتباط و انتقال داده بین سرور های وب و مرورگر ها مورد استفاده قرار می گیرد.

برای فهم بهتر این که https با http چه فرقی دارد باید به این نکته توجه کرد که https اتصال بین مرورگر و سرور وب را با یک پروتکل امنیتی دیجیتال ایمن می کند که در این پروتکل از کلید های رمزنگاری برای امنیت و حفظ داده ها استفاده می شود. ساده ترین و بهترین راه برای استفاده از https و ثبت شدن به عنوان یک دامنه امن، دریافت گواهینامه لایه های سوکت امن یا همان SSL و TLS است.

البته نکته ای که باید بدانید این است TLS در حال تبدیل شدن به استاندارد جدیدی برای https است؛ اما اکثر گواهی های SSL نیز هنوز به عنوان یک استاندارد پذیرفته شده محسوب می شوند.

پروتکل https و http چگونه کار می کند؟

https با http چه فرقی دارد

اگر بخواهیم در این پاسخ این سوال که https با http چه فرقی دارد، دقیق تر شویم باید بگوییم که تفاوتی بین این دو از لحاظ عملکرد وجود ندارد؛ چرا که http یک پروتکل کاربردی است که مرورگر های وب و سرور های وب برای ارتباط از طریق اینترنت از آن استفاده می کند.

نحوه کار https نیز بسیار ساده است. هنگامی که یک کاربر وب می خواهد از سایتی بازدید کند، ابتدا مرورگر وب او یک درخواست http را برای سرور اصلی سایت که حاوی فایل های وب سایت است ارسال می کند. درخواست http شامل چند خط متنی است که از طریق اینترنت برای سرور ارسال می شود. بعد از آن یک ارتباط بین مرورگر و سرور شکل می گیرد. بعد از این که سرور درخواست را پردازش کرد، یک پاسخ http برای کاربر ارسال می کند و اینگونه امکان دسترسی به سایت و بازدید از آن امکان پذیر می شود.

http یا https ؟ کدام یک برای سایت من بهتر است؟

http یا https

برای پاسخ به این سوال از نظر فنی جواب دقیقی وجود ندارد؛ زیرا همه چیز به نوع سایتی که دارید بستگی دارد. برای مثال یک وب سایت نمونه کار ساده با یک سایت تجارت الکترونیک که برای استفاده از آن مجبور به ثبت نام و وارد کردن مشخصات کارت اعتباری خود هستید، تفاوت های بسیار زیادی دارد. البته به طور کلی مهم نیست که سایت شما اطلاعات حساس را مدیریت می کند یا خیر؛ چرا که https در حال تبدیل شدن به یک استاندارد برای تمامی وب سایت است. اگر هنوز هم بین انتخاب این دو پروتکل شک دارید، عوامل زیر را در نظر بگیرید تا انتخاب بهتری داشته باشید:

در این قسمت درمورد این که از لحاظ امنیتی https با http چه فرقی دارد توضیح خواهیم داد. بر اساس یک نظرسنجی معتبر حدود 77 درصد از کاربران اینترنت نگران سوء استفاده یا رهگیری از داده ها توسط کاربران غیر مجاز هستند. به همین دلیل استفاده از یک پروتکل امنیتی مناسب برای دادن اطمینان خاطر به کاربران از اهمیت زیادی برخوردار است. به طور کلی https از http از لحاظ امنیتی بسیار بهتر عمل می کند؛ چون پروتکل http اصلا اتصالات را رمز گذاری نمی کند. به همین دلیل اطلاعاتی که بر بستر پروتکل http جا به جا می شوند، برای هر کسی از جمله مجرمان سایبری قابل مشاهده است.

بر اساس داده ها https تقریبا جایگزین http شده است. از سپتامبر 2021 گزارش های گوگل نشان می دهد که 99 درصد از زمان مرور کاربران کروم در سایت هایی با پروتکل https صرف می شود. علاوه بر این تقریبا 30 درصد از کاربران حین بازدید از سایت به دنبال نماد قفل می گردند و نماد قفل تنها زمانی نمایان خواهد شد که شما از پروتکل https استفاده کنید.

طبق گفته گوگل استفاده از پروتکل https نه تنها برای افزایش امنیت سایت ضروری است، بلکه باعث بهبود سئو سایت هایی که از https به جای http استفاده می کنند، خواهد شد.

مزایای سئو

پروتکل https با مصرف کم منابع و به حداکثر رساندن کارایی پهنای باند سرعت بارگذاری سایت را به حداکثر می رساند. به خصوص اگر سروری که سایت در آن میزبانی می شود از پروتکل http/2 پشتیبانی کند.

جمع بندی

http و https هر دو پروتکلی هستند که عملکرد یکسانی دارند و برای حفاظت از داده های کاربران طراحی شده اند؛ اما تفاوت هایی بسیار زیادی بین این دو از لحاظ مزایای سئو، محبوبیت و از همه مهم تر امنیت سایت وجود دارد. به طور کلی می توان گفت که https تقریبا از هر لحاظی به Https برتری دارد؛ ولی برای این که بدانید که Https با http چه فرقی دارد، در این مقاله در مورد تفاوت و ویژگی های این دو توضیح داده شد.

 

source